Found

+Broadest medication menu among GLP-1 telehealth programs (compounded semaglutide/tirzepatide, branded GLP-1s, metformin, topiramate, Contrave, zonisamide) via a personalized assessment
+Compounded medication cost is bundled into the monthly plan fee rather than billed separately, so the advertised price is closer to the real one
+Multiple insurance partnerships (BCBS, Cigna, UnitedHealthcare, Aetna, Anthem) with copays reported around $30
Reddit/Trustpilot reports of 'misleading pricing' and unexpected charges, particularly around insurance and Medicare coverage representation
Entry-level $99/mo price requires a 12-month prepay commitment; month-to-month cash pricing runs closer to $289/mo
Customer service responsiveness reported as inconsistent, especially for shipment problems

FuturHealth

+Large, well-established review base: 15,774 Trustpilot reviews at a 4.6 average
+Longest operating history in this group (founded 2017)
+Dietitian-designed GLP-1 nutrition plans and Apple Fitness+ bundled into membership
Stacked pricing structure (membership fee + medication cost) pushes all-in cost to $328-427/mo, higher than single-fee competitors
Patients report being billed after cancellation and difficulty obtaining refunds
Customer support described as slow and inconsistent by multiple reviewers
